Shwedagon Pagoda Trustees Board calls for bid to purchase over 2.4 mln gold foils

Myanmar girls are seen making stage 6 of gold foils at a workshop.

Tenders will be invited for over 2,400,000 gold foils to be used in gold foil offering to Shwedagon Pagoda, according to the statement released by Shwedagon Pagoda Board of Trustees on 16 January.
The board stated that 1,000,000 gold foils made by machine and 1,400,000 traditional handmade gold foils will be purchased through bidding.
Rules for the competitive bidding system can be purchased at the board’s office at K10,000 per tender application form and procurement guidelines between 23 and 27 January 2023 within office hours.
Additionally, open tendering for traditional gold foil suppliers will be held at 1 pm on 14 February at the ancient Buddha stupas shrine in the south of the pagoda platform. After that, tender evaluation for gold foil manufacturers will be continued at 3 pm on the same day.—TWA/EMM
